2000 Toyota Solara Power Steering Pump Parts Q&A

  • Q: How to service and repair the Power Steering Pump on 2000 Toyota Solara?
    A: You must approach the Power Steering Pump disassembly with caution because vise tightening should be avoided. Check the PS vane pump rotating torque that should be below 0.3 Nm (2.8 kgf-cm, 2.4 inch lbs.) without any irregular noise during smooth operation. Use Special Service Tool: 09960-10010 (09962-01000, 09963-01000) to cease the pulley rotation before your removal of the pulley nut. Next, separate the front and rear brackets by pulling out 3 bolts and 2 nuts while you should then detach both the suction port union with its O-ring. Proceed to remove the pressure port union and flow control valve and spring and their necessary O-ring. Remove four housing bolts and two O-rings as a first step until you can separate the wave washer and side plate with gasket while also extracting the cam ring and vane plates, rotor, and taking attention to keep all components safe from falling. The service technician separates the front housing vane pump shaft from its two straight pins. A proper inspection demands measurement of the vane pump shaft oil clearance against the bushing using micrometric and calipertic instruments to maintain standard values between 0.03 - 0.05 mm (0.00 12 - 0.0020 inch) while staying below the maximum limit of 0.07 mm (0.0028 inch). The inspection of vane plates and rotor for height must exceed 8.6 mm (0.339 inch) while thickness must surpass 1.397 mm (0.0550 inch) and length must exceed 14.991 mm (0.5902 inch) simultaneously. The maximum allowable clearance between the rotor groove and plate should not reach 0.035 mm (0.0014 inch). The flow control valve inspection requires power steering fluid application followed by a check for proper valve hole entry and compressed air leak testing; install a new valve if needed with markings A through F. The spring free length measurement should be at minimum 32.3 mm (1.272 inch) before replacing it when out of specification. Repaying with a screwdriver taped in vinyl will safely remove the oil seal while Special Service Tool: 09950-60010 (09951-00330), 09950-70010 (09951-07100) should be used for fitting in a fresh oil seal with power steering fluid application to its lip. Proper orientation must be maintained. Begin reassembly by applying power steering fluid to specified components and subsequently install the vane pump shaft along with the straight pins without causing damage to them. First install the cam ring in its proper position while facing outward toward the rear housing. Afterward place the vane pump rotor together with a new snap ring. Arrange the 10 vane plates so their round areas face the outside while adding a new gasket and side plate which should have their holes matched with straight pins. The wave washer installation requires proper slot insertion into the side plate before applying power steering fluid to new O-rings. Then install the O-rings into the rear housing and lock it with four bolts reaching 17 Nm (170 kgf-cm, 12 ft. lbs.). Credit the pressure port union with power steering fluid before tightening its components to 83 Nm (850 kgf-cm, 62 ft. lbs.). The flow control valve and spring must face the right direction according to installation specifications. Install the suction port union using a new O-ring then a bolt tightened to 13 Nm (130 kgf-cm, 9 ft. lbs.) followed by the front and rear brackets fastened with 3 bolts and 2 nuts at 43 Nm (440 kgf-cm, 32 ft. lbs.). Install the vane pump pulley followed by torquing its nut to 43 Nm while controlling its rotation using Special Service Tool: 09960-10010 (09962-01000, 09963-01000) before another PS vane pump rotating torque measurement.
